    The TOG figures, whilst extracted from Champion Data are not the most reliable. Between substitute and substituted, they are often greater than 100%.
    I am still trying to source a more reliable TOG.

    Quote Originally Posted by ugg View Post
    Froggy, or anyone else for that matter, do you have the time during the quarter that they came on the ground? It would be interesting to see if the sub spends less time rotated on the bench than the other players.
    I can find when the substitution occurred (at 3QT, during Q4, injury Q1) but not the exact time in that quarter (FanFooty Archives)
    stats.rleague, footywire, AFL, Herald/Sun do not seem to list that info at this stage - I'm sure someone has it, just not yet ...
